Sorry to hear. Have a good look around the suspension mounting points. Don't want to scare you but I think if these are bent/knackered then it's new chassis time.

Gutted for you mate, BUT pleased to hear it was only a small 'off' and nobody hurt.

Best get it to a specialist to have a full alignment check. If you're lucky, a new wheel and geo set-up, if you're unlucky.... well, that's why you pay your insurance.
